Prince Rupert Cruise Port , the first North American Port for GPH, began its 2023 cruise season with back-to-back calls on May 3rd and 4th. The first call of the season was by Carnival Miracle, which allowed Prince Rupert to welcome 2,018 passengers sailing on a 14-day Alaskan itinerary. The inaugural call was marked with a plaque exchange ceremony attended by Port GM Kevin D’Costa, Captain Roberto Costi, Indigenous leader Hereditary Chief Alex Campbell, Prince Rupert Port Authority representatives, and other key officials.

Prince Rupert, nestled in The Great Bear Rainforest, is a captivating gem located in the pristine waters of British Columbia, Canada. Known for its breathtaking natural beauty and rich Ts’msyen cultural heritage, this island serves as a tranquil haven for both locals and visitors alike. With its lush forests, rugged coastline, and majestic mountains, Prince Rupert Island offers a myriad of outdoor adventures, from hiking and kayaking to wildlife spotting and fishing. The island is home to diverse wildlife, including bears, eagles, and whales, adding to its allure. Steeped in Indigenous history, the island carries a deep spiritual significance and is dotted with ancient totem poles and cultural sites. The warm and welcoming community embraces visitors, offering a glimpse into their vibrant traditions and vivacious arts scene.

Prince Rupert Cruise Port GM Kevin D'Costa expressed excitement for the season, emphasizing the overwhelming community response as he looks ahead to a very promising 2023 season.
